Toyota will flood the market with cheap electric cars: what is known

Toyota was skeptical about battery electric cars until recently. Now the company has decided to flood the market with cheap electric cars. The goal is to increase annual sales to millions of units worldwide.
The ambitious plans of the Japanese concern were reported by MarketWatch. Toyota intends to increase sales of electric cars to 1.5 million copies by 2026. This will be facilitated by 10 new models. These electric cars must be affordable if the company expects high sales.
What's more, it plans to increase annual sales to 3.5 million units worldwide by 2030. The company is preparing a next-generation EV lineup with solid-state batteries. This technology will make mass production cheaper and will help achieve a range of 1,000 kilometers.
We are talking about the total sales of the entire Toyota group together with its subsidiaries Daihatsu and Lexus. The latter will be responsible for premium, the most expensive and qualitatively equipped electric models.
